Creating a wood fence in Elk Grove Village, IL, is a venture that merges both aesthetic appeal and practical functionality. This essay will explore the nuances of setting up a wooden barrier in this suburban haven, highlighting considerations often overlooked.
Firstly, selecting durable lumber is crucial for longevity. However, residents might prioritize exotic woods without recognizing local climate demands. Cedar or pressure-treated pine typically withstand hardy midwestern winters better than less probable choices like bamboo or eucalyptus.
Secondly, defining property boundaries precisely before construction is essential to avoid disputes with neighbors. Surprisingly, some homeowners commence digging post holes without consulting updated plat surveys, risking later legal confrontations.
Thirdly, understanding village ordinances governing fence heights and materials ensures compliance and avoids costly modifications post-installation. Ignorantly constructing an oversized fortress could lead to penalties from unaware municipal authorities enforcing strict zoning laws.
Fourthly, employing experienced contractors can make the difference between a sturdy wall and one susceptible to premature decay. Novices frequently misjudge the complexity of installation, underestimating factors such as soil composition or proper post anchoring techniques.
Lastly, considering maintenance requirements over time saves future labor and expense. Intricately carved pickets may enchant at first glance but could prove nightmares to repaint or repair compared to utilitarian designs selected with foresight.
In conclusion, erecting a wood fence in Elk Grove Village requires thoughtful planning beyond mere aesthetics. Wise material selection combined with legal diligence and professional assistance guarantees not only an attractive demarcation but also one that stands resilient against both legal challenges and the rigors of Illinois weather.
